Linuxカーネル2.6のプロセススケジューラには、スケーラビリティがあります。Linuxカーネル2.4以前のプロセススケジューラは非常に単純な構造で、マルチプロセッサシステムであっても、単一のキューに実行可能プロセスをすべてつなぎ、再スケジューリング ...
プロセスディスパッチャは、指定されたプロセスに実行権を与える、つまりCPUを割り当てる処理を行いました。しかし、どのプロセスに実行権を与えるかの判断は行いません。 実行可能なプロセス群全体を監視し、どのプロセスに実行権を与えるか判断を ...
コンピューター上でUbuntuを動かすために必要になるLinuxカーネルは、 Ubuntuにおいてもっとも重要なコンポーネントです。今回はそんなLinuxカーネルとUbuntuの関係について説明します。 Ubuntuカーネルのことを知ろう Ubuntuは 「Linuxカーネル」 を使ったLinux ...
無料オンラインコース「Linuxカーネル開発 初心者向けガイド」 2025年11月20日 東京発 — Linux Foundation Education は、カーネルコミュニティと協力し、生産的なメンバーになるために必要な知識を学習することを目的とする無料オンラインコース「Linuxカーネル ...
Ubuntuのカーネルパッケージは、 Linuxカーネルにいくつもの手を加えUbuntuのさまざまな機能にとって必要なConfigを有効にしたうえで作成しています。今回はそのUbuntuカーネルパッケージを少しだけカスタマイズしてビルドする方法を紹介します。 カーネル ...
オープンソースを通じた大規模イノベーションの実現に取り組む非営利団体である Linux Foundation は 10月15日 (現地時間)、新たに無料のオンラインコース A Beginner’s Guide to Linux Kernel Development (Linuxカーネル開発のビギナー向けガイド) を開始したことを発表し ...
Apple独自のArmベースSoCである「M1」チップを搭載したMacでもLinuxを動作させることを目指すAsahi Linuxプロジェクトが、Apple M1への初期サポートをLinuxのSoCツリーに統合したことを発表しました。M1ブート環境への対応は、2021年7月頃にリリースが予定されている ...
一部の結果でアクセス不可の可能性があるため、非表示になっています。
アクセス不可の結果を表示する